The stock market may be hitting new records all the time, but under the surface lurk companies that draw the ire of hedge funds.
They span industries ranging from retail to internet software, and they’ve earned the unfortunate distinction of either being overvalued, or downright fundamentally flawed.
To see which stocks bear the biggest burden of hedge fund shorts, the equity strategy team at Goldman Sachs analyzed 821 funds that hold a combined $1.9 trillion in gross equity positions.
Goldman then identified the stocks that have the highest short interest as a percentage of shares outstanding. They limit the screen to companies that have market caps greater than $1 billion, and are also held by 10 or more hedge funds.
Here’s a list of the 11 stocks in the index that best fit that criteria:

11. Greenbrier Companies
Ticker: GBX
Subsector: Construction machinery & heavy trucks
Total return year-to-date: 9%
Short interest as % of market cap: 31%
Source: Goldman Sachs
10. Pandora Media
Ticker: P
Subsector: Internet software & services
Total return year-to-date: -25%
Short interest as % of market cap: 32%
Source: Goldman Sachs
9. Frontier Communications
Ticker: FTR
Subsector: Integrated telecom services
Total return year-to-date: -60%
Short interest as % of market cap: 32%
Source: Goldman Sachs
8. Seritage Growth Properties
Ticker: SRG
Subsector: Retail REITs
Total return year-to-date: -7%
Short interest as % of market cap: 33%
Source: Goldman Sachs
7. Big Lots
Ticker: BIG
Subsector: General merchandise stores
Total return year-to-date: -6%
Short interest as % of market cap: 35%
Source: Goldman Sachs
6. Restoration Hardware
Ticker: RH
Subsector: Home furnishing retail
Total return year-to-date: 86%
Short interest as % of market cap: 35%
Source: Goldman Sachs
5. Banc of California
Ticker: BANC
Subsector: Regional banks
Total return year-to-date: 20%
Short interest as % of market cap: 36%
Source: Goldman Sachs
4. Twilio
Ticker: TWLO
Subsector: Internet software & services
Total return year-to-date: -16%
Short interest as % of market cap: 36%
Source: Goldman Sachs
3. BofI Holding
Ticker: BOFI
Subsector: Thrifts & mortgage finance
Total return year-to-date: -17%
Short interest as % of market cap: 38%
Source: Goldman Sachs
2. Avis Budget Group
Ticker: CAR
Subsector: Trucking
Total return year-to-date: -35%
Short interest as % of market cap: 42%
Source: Goldman Sachs
1. JCPenney
Ticker: JCP
Subsector: Department stores
Total return year-to-date: -48%
Short interest as % of market cap: 44%
Source: Goldman Sachs
